I tried searching the forums for this but the search features leave a lot to be desired. Even putting in "farm AND endo" got me way too many hits for threads that had nothing to do with the topic I'm looking for.  

I've found ways to get everything else in this game except Endo, especially for the mods that have 10 ranks and need like 30k endo each to max out.  I know ayatan's are a great source, but they aren't that easy to farm.  There's the weekly Maru hunt, daily sorties which aren't a guaranteed and that's it.  They MIGHT show up in syndicate missions.  I'm looking for good ways to RELIABLY farm endo and lots of it.  It's weird that there's no way (that I know of) to farm a resource like this like there is for Kuva, something I almost never use.

Arbitration Excavation. 45 minutes, I got like 20k endo I think. That's with sculptures and the base endo reward. Survival, Defense, Interception, and Defection all take 2x longer to farm, so avoid those modes, and wait patiently for an excavation, get a squad up that's willing to go for like 20+ digs, and get some endo.

Rathuum node, get a Nekros for Desecrate, a Nidus to pull everything together with Larva, and a whole lot of damage. Runs can be as short as 2.5 minutes per round and net up to about 1k endo, though that varies heavily depending on what modifier you get.

Also, Arbitrations.

Play any mission you like as long you maximize the loot potential, survivals are excelent for ayatan statues and stars, 10 minutes should give you (hopefully) as much endo as an arbitration, altough far easier, meaning more kills.

Kills get you more endo drops and mods, mods can be traded for ayatan statues. I for example often trade mods from nightmare missions, arbitrations and regular missions for ayatan statues, meaning a simle 2 minute capture can give you a mod that can net you several ayatan statues in trade chat, beating arbitrations rewards by a long shot.

The more you farm, the more "endo potential" you get.

2 kill captures, being unaware of statues, not destroying crates for stars, negleting loot, kills and being static in missions means you depend on mission rewards alone to get the endo you need, while the endo in arbitrations and some gamemodes like excavation are good, they are far from the best source.

If on the other hand you do a 20 minute survival arbitration, get 1 statue as a reward, get 1 statue because you found it in the map, get 3 ayatan stars, get an adaptation mod that you later trade for 5 filled ayatan statues, the endo you get from regular kills, all of that combined will easily beat the measly 1 statue from arbitration as a farming method.

If you do nightmare missions and trade the mods you always get for 2 filled ayatan statues, 10 minutes of gametime may give you over 8 filled ayatan statues

The better you perform gamewise, the more endo you get overall, especially when trading things.

If you trade for platinum, then use the platinum to buy statues, same thing, a well sold warframe prime set can give you enough plat to buy many statues.

Arbitrations in my opinion are the best place get endo, as it can reward endo or ayatan sculptures for every rotation.

Rotation A gives:

  • 1300 Endo (36.5%)
  • Ayatan Ayr Sculpture (18%)
  • Ayatan Sah Sculpture (18%)
  • Ayatan Valana Sculpture (18%)

Rotation B gives:

  • 1600 Endo (48%)
  • Ayatan Piv Sculpture (20%)
  • Ayatan Vaya Sculpture (20%)

Rotation C gives:

  • 2000 Endo (52.5%)
  • Ayatan Orta Sculpture (29%)

However if you don't have access to Arbitrations, farming Rathuum node (preferably with Nekros or Nidus) and selling unwanted mods for endo in bulk are good alternatives.

In addition, weekly ayatan treasure hunts can help, though the sculptures they give will only net you around 1000 - 1500 endo at most. Its small, but at least you can make around 1000 endo every week. If you are struggling with these missions use Titania as flying makes most of them trivial. Doing Sorites every day can also help as there is a 12.10% chance to get 4000 endo as a reward or a 28.00% chance for a Anasa Ayatan Sculpture. I recommend doing both sorties and treasure hunts in addition to Arbitrations or farming Rathuum to maximize the amount of endo you get.

Lastly I would also like to mention that even though you can buy endo in the shop for 100 or 50 plat, its basically a scam. If you are willing to spend plat for endo, buying 1000 endo from the shop for 100 plat is a joke, buy already filled Ayatan Sculptures on warframe.market instead. Already filled Anasa Ayatan Sculptures for example cost around 15-25 plat and give 3450 endo. Therefore if you spend 100 on 4 filled Anasa Ayatan Sculptures, you get 13800 endo from Maroo, as oppose to 1000 from the shop.

Jupiter IO defense. You need a speed Nova necros hydroid and a forth. Another hydroid would be great. 

 20 waves takes about 14 minutes and nets about 2200 Endo per run. Most of that is from converting mods to Endo. 

 Best thing is you also have a chance for neural sensors and most of the relics on the rotations on iO are worth using

 Also most importantly bring slash based weapons. Necros desecrates multiple body parts if they're available from slash based weapons

Raathum arena is like 50 seconds and 600-1400 endo depends on RNG and team setup. Arbitration excav/defection is lots of endo/statues pretty fast. And also Sedna-Hieracon is decent endo farm 400 endo per rotation and can be very fast with decent team and also drop Axi relics and cryotic which you gonna need decent amount for crafting. Sell duplicate mods for endo like once per month, it will add up to decent amount.
